
Advisor Sentiment Index Reveals Growing Market Confidence
In the latest Advisor Sentiment Index, financial advisors’ outlook on the stock market shows signs of improvement for the second consecutive month, signaling increasing confidence in the face of economic uncertainty. The current optimism, nearly a 30% increase from March lows following the Trump administration's initial tariff announcements, suggests that advisors are beginning to reconcile their investments with expected market adjustments.
Understanding the Economic Landscape
Despite the optimism reflected in the sentiment index, concerns about the broader economy remain a pressing issue among advisors. As of May, only 33% expressed a positive view of the economic landscape, which indicates a considerable level of apprehension about the ongoing impacts of tariffs and trade negotiations on inflation and consumer behavior. Financial advisors remain concerned about possible price increases driven by tariffs, which could stall business investments and lead to a consumer pullback.
Tariffs and Their Economic Implications
The dominant factor affecting advisors' sentiment continues to be the uncertainty surrounding trade policies. With nearly 45% predicting an economic decline in the upcoming six months, advisors appear cautious about how tariff negotiations will unfold. Many believe these discussions could serve as a critical inflection point for either economic recovery or further declines.

Long-term Forecasts Reflect Cautious Optimism
Interestingly, while immediate forecasts show significant apprehension, a greater level of optimism emerges regarding a longer-term horizon. Almost 60% of financial advisors believe that economic conditions will improve over the next year, a shift that points to an evolving sentiment influenced by potential resolution of existing tariff policies.
